Literacy |
By the end of 2013, student performance will increase by 5% on each EQAO assessment of literacy.
|
- regular grade level meetings
- Lunch and Learns workshop on various curriculum related strategies
- Family Literacy Network Stream for Junior
- effective integration of students with special needs
- implementation of Learning Walks
- full integration of students with ASD into classrooms at all grade levels
- Connections Meetings with Itinerant Special Education Team for IBI students
- triads held on an on-going basis to monitor and identify students at-risk (classroom teacher, Special Education Teacher, principal)
- on-going involvement of Social Worker and Child and Youth Worker on principal recommendation and/or parental request

Pathways and Transitions |
By June 2013, the percentage of SK students assessed as being ready for school according to the Early Development Instrument will increase compared to the results from the 2009-2010 assessment.
|
- Special Services team (psychologist, social worker, parents, Special Education teacher) conference with student regarding identification and learning strengths and needs
- Transition meetings with secondary school staff, Grade 8 teachers and Special Education students
- Connections Meetings with Itinerant Special Education Team for IBI students
- Case conferences for admission and transfer of Special Education students
- Focus on strategies which promote student independence and self-advocacy skills

Expanded Accountability and Transparency |
By the end of June 2013, the school will report balanced budgets on an annual basis.
By June 2013, the School Councils will adhere to the collection, recording and reporting processes for funds that are generated through their activities. |
· Staff to access PD place professional development for training opportunities on budgeting process and procedures
· Staff will continue to develop knowledge and use of the Financial Support Tool provided through the Finance Department
· School Council chairs will yearly receive the DP Catholic School Council Resource Handbook outlining processes in handling funds
· School Council members will be encouraged to attend Board and Family level in-services and training sessions including Board-wide training every October for the specific roles of the Council |
